Experiencing Eviction Help: Protecting Your Rights and Home

Eviction can be a stressful time, leaving you feeling desperate. It's important to remember that you have rights under the law. First, attempt to talk to your landlord about your circumstances for falling behind on rent. They may be willing to work with you to find a solution.

If communication fails, it's crucial help finding apartment with eviction to consult with an attorney. A lawyer can advise you through the eviction process and ensure fair treatment.

Remember that an eviction notice doesn't mean you instantly have to leave your home. Understand your choices carefully, as there are often steps you can take to keep a roof over your head.

Various resources exist to help you through this difficult time.

  • Research local tenant's rights groups for guidance.
  • Apply for rental assistance programs in your area.
  • Don't ignore eviction notices. Respond promptly and seek clarification carefully.

By understanding your rights, you can address this pressure-filled moment.

Facing Eviction: Support Every Step of the Way

Facing eviction can be an incredibly stressful and overwhelming experience. It can appear as if your whole world is turning upside down. But take heart, you are not alone in this situation, and there can be found resources available to help you every step of the way.

One of the most important things you can do is understand your your rights as a tenant. Each state has its own regulations regarding eviction, so it's crucial to look into what applies in your area. You should also reaching out to a legal aid organization or an attorney who specializes in tenant rights. They can provide you with advice on how to handle the eviction process and protect your rights.

Remember, you are not powerless in this situation. By seeking help, you can improve your odds of successfully navigating this challenging time.
